Orchestra Life Sciences Chooses the Navy Yard for New Global Headquarters

Two scientists in a lab

Welcome Orchestra Life Sciences to the Navy Yard! Orchestra is a rapidly growing technical consultancy that supports advanced therapy manufacturing that has relocated its global headquarters from Montreal to Philadelphia. The move marks an important milestone for Orchestra and reinforces the Navy Yard’s leadership as a hub for life sciences innovation, job creation, and workforce

A New Chapter for the Navy Yard Shuttle: Partnership with Yankee Line

Image of bus.

Starting October 1, Yankee Line will operate the Navy Yard Transit shuttle service, bringing their expertise and commitment to high-quality service to our campus.  As the Navy Yard continues to expand, reliable and accessible transit options are more important than ever.
